**Special Notice 36C26324Q0934 INTENT TO SOLE SOURCE:** The procurement of a DVR and Neural Data System from Plexon to interface with the Omniplex data acquisition system for the Iowa City VA Medical Center. This is a Notice of Intent published in accordance with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) 5.101(a)(1) requiring the dissemination of information regarding proposed contract actions.

This Notice of Intent is for a proposed award of a short term, sole source, firm fixed price contract under the authority of 41 U.S.C. 3304(a)(1), as implemented by FAR 13.106-1(b) - Contracting officers may solicit from one source if the contracting officer determines that the circumstances of the contract action deem only one source reasonably available.

The Department of Veterans Affairs, Network 23 Contracting Office intends to award a short term, sole source, firm fixed price contract to Plexon. to provide a DVR and Neural Data System from Plexon to interface with the Omniplex data acquisition system for the Iowa City VA Medical Center.
